Ambient Air Temperature Sensor Circuit B Intermittent/Erratic

Descripción
This code indicates that the ambient air temperature sensor 'B' is giving inconsistent or erratic readings. The signal from the sensor is jumping around, making it difficult for the car's computer to get a reliable temperature reading.
Causas comunes
- Faulty ambient air temperature sensor 'B'
- Wiring issue to the ambient air temperature sensor 'B'
- Loose or corroded electrical connector
- Intermittent fault in the sensor itself
- Problem with the engine control module (ECM)
Síntomas
- Check Engine light is on
- Inaccurate outside temperature display
- Fluctuating engine performance
- Poor fuel economy
Pasos de reparación
- 1 Check the electrical connector at the ambient air temperature sensor 'B' for looseness, corrosion, or damage and clean or reseat it as needed.
- 2 Inspect the wiring harness running to the ambient air temperature sensor 'B' for chafing, fraying, broken wires, or exposure to heat damage.
- 3 Clear the diagnostic trouble code and monitor for intermittent recurrence while wiggling the connector and wiring to identify loose connections.
- 4 Test the ambient air temperature sensor 'B' with a multimeter to verify resistance values match manufacturer specifications across a range of temperatures.
- 5 Repair or replace any damaged wiring or connectors found in the sensor 'B' circuit.
- 6 Replace the ambient air temperature sensor 'B' if testing confirms erratic or out-of-range readings.
- 7 Have the engine control module (ECM) inspected and tested by a professional if all sensor and wiring checks pass without finding a fault.
